Subject: Partner SFTP drop — new owner

Hi,

As you review the pending changes to the Harborline ingest scripts, note that ownership of the partner SFTP drop is changing at the end of the month. This includes key rotation, the nightly pull job, and the quarantine folder for malformed files. Review comments on the retry logic should still go through the normal PR flow, but questions about drop-folder conventions or partner onboarding now go to the new owner. The incoming owner is listed below.

signatory, tagaf-bahaf: Praael Fenmir Rusok

## Fuel Report Job — Runbook Fragment

If your plugin hooks into the Tallowick fleet fuel-usage report, remember it runs nightly and your hook gets the aggregated rows, not raw pump events. Don't mutate the dataframe in place — clone it first, or the Harborline exporter downstream gets confused. Plugins run with the same settings as the core job, shown below.

service settings:
[pelius]
port = 5432
team = praius
host = pelius.crelvoforge.internal
region = upper-4
access_code = ac_8f224d
timeout_ms = 2000

Action item: Last week's Quillseeker relevance regression came from an undocumented boost-weight change that broke several third-party plugins. Going forward, all tuning changes will be logged with effective dates and affected signal names, and plugin authors get a two-week notice window before weights shift. Please review your scoring assumptions against the current notes. The tuning changelog and notification policy are published at the page below.

wiki page, tahaf-tajog: https://jira.ordindyn.corp/pipeline

Pilot: Fernhollow Retail Chain (Managers Only)

Quick update for branch managers — the Fernhollow pilot kicks off in three of their stores next month, using our Shelfwise tracking kit. Keep this off the floor for now; staff briefings come later. Dario from partnerships is handling logistics, so route questions his way. There's more context on where this could lead just below.

management briefing: Jorixax Holdings is in early talks to buy Casixax Holdings for about $420.3 million. The Fenmir launch date is October 27, and nothing goes to the press before then. Legal wants the Keloxek Foods term sheet redrafted before April 16.